As families celebrate Christmas Day 2025, many people are asking the same question: Is McDonald’s open or closed on Christmas? The answer depends on your location, as holiday hours vary by restaurant.
McDonald’s does not operate under a single nationwide schedule on Christmas Day. Because most locations are owned and operated by local franchisees, some restaurants will be open with limited or adjusted hours, while others may remain closed for the holiday.
Typically, McDonald’s outlets in busy areas such as airports, highways, hospitals, and major cities are more likely to stay open, often serving customers for part of the day. However, even open locations may offer shortened hours or a limited menu, especially later in the evening.
Customers planning a Christmas Day visit are advised to check the McDonald’s official app or restaurant locator, which provides the most accurate and up-to-date holiday hours. Calling the restaurant directly is another reliable way to confirm availability before heading out.
